G1761 - Thoughts
| Strong's No.: | G1761 | 
| Greek: | ἐνθύμησις | 
| Transliteration: | enthumēsis | 
| Phonetic: | en-thoo'-may-sis | 
| Word Origin: | From G1760 | 
| Bible Usage: | device thought. | 
| Part of Speech: | Noun Feminine | 
| Strongs Definition:  | deliberation  | 
| Thayers Definition:  | 1. a thinking, consideration 2. thoughts  |
